// EXIF_SCRUB_POLICY controls metadata removal on all images uploaded through
// the Lorren support portal. GPS coordinates, device serials, and owner tags
// are stripped before storage; orientation is preserved. If a customer reports
// missing photo metadata, this is expected behavior, not a bug. Reference the
// scrubber build token below when escalating.

session token of yajof-bagef = htk4_937d

## 3.2.0 — Changed defaults: image slimming

The Corvine build pipeline now strips debug symbols, locale data, and package caches from all service images by default. Previously this required opting in per repo. Average image size dropped roughly 60% in our canary fleet, and cold-start pull times improved accordingly. Teams needing a shell for live debugging must set the keep-tools flag explicitly before the 3.2.0 rollout window closes. The new default values shipped with this release are listed below.

settings of fafog-haduf:
ZORIX_PIN=4648
ZORIX_METRICS_HOST=metrics.zorix.paliqsys.corp
ZORIX_LOG_LEVEL=info
ZORIX_TENANT=druix

## Local Setup

ChipGate reads timing-chip pings from the mat controllers and writes splits to Postgres. Requirements: Docker, Go 1.22.

1. Clone the repo.
2. `make seed` loads sample race data.
3. `make run` starts the reader on port 7070.

The reader expects the splits database to be reachable. Configure it with the connection string below.

primary connection of yagep-kahip = redis://giliel_svc:zYiKsLL2PLpfPL@db-348f.xolmarsys.corp:5432/fenwyn